NIT Delhi Scholarships 2026: Schemes, Eligibility, and Benefits

NIT Delhi Scholarship programs for 2026 offer financial aid up to Rs. 10,000 annually to support students across various categories and economic backgrounds. These initiatives, coordinated by the institute's Scholarship Cell, aim to reduce financial burdens and promote higher education access.

2025-26 Key Scholarship Schemes
NIT Delhi students can access a range of scholarships, including those offered by central and state governments, as well as institutional support. The table below details prominent schemes available for the 2025-26 academic year.
| Scheme Name | Authority | Annual Benefit (INR) | Primary Eligibility | Application Window (2025-26)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Merit Scholarship for SC/ST/OBC/Minorities | Government of India / NIT Delhi Scholarship Cell | Varies, up to 10,000 | SC/ST/OBC/Minority students, pursuing college-level studies, merit-based selection. | Generally open in late 2025, specific dates vary. |
| Post Matric Scholarship for OBC Students | Ministry of Social Justice and Empowerment, GOVT. OF INDIA / Delhi Government | Varies, up to 10,000 | OBC students, post-matriculation studies, income criteria. | 10.10.2025 - 31.01.2026 (for Delhi residents via e-district). |
| State-Funded Scholarship Schemes (Delhi Domicile) | GNCT of Delhi | 5,000 or 10,000 | Delhi Domicile, SC/ST/OBC/Minority, specific academic performance. | 31.10.2025 - 31.03.2026 (e-District Delhi Portal). |
| NIT Delhi Internal Financial Assistance | NIT Delhi Scholarship Cell | Varies based on need and merit | Meritorious students, economically weaker sections, reserved categories, specific regions. | Announced by NIT Delhi. |
| Welfare of SC/ST/OBC/Minorities Merit Scholarship | Government of India | Varies, based on central guidelines | SC/ST/OBC/Minority students enrolled in professional institutions. | Annual application cycle. |
2025-26 Eligibility Criteria for Government Scholarships
Eligibility for government-backed scholarships often involves specific documentation and adherence to guidelines set by the respective authorities. Key criteria for the 2025-26 academic year are summarized below.
| Criterion | Requirement | Applicable Schemes |
|---|---|---|
| Caste Certificate | Valid SC/ST/OBC/Minority certificate issued by competent authority. | All category-specific scholarships. |
| Domicile | Delhi Domicile Certificate (if caste certificate not from Delhi). | State-funded schemes by GNCT of Delhi. |
| Aadhaar Number | Mandatory for online applications. | All online applications via e-District Delhi Portal. |
| Academic Performance | Mark sheet of previous academic year; minimum pass percentage. | Merit Scholarship, renewal of schemes. |
| Income Proof | Valid income certificate of parents/guardian. | Income-based scholarships for EWS/OBC. |
| Enrollment Status | Proof of studying in a recognized college/professional institution. | All schemes. |
2025-26 Scholarship Benefits by Student Category
Scholarship opportunities at NIT Delhi are tailored to support students from various backgrounds, including reserved categories and those demonstrating academic merit. The benefits can vary significantly by student group.
| Student Category | Applicable Schemes (Examples) | Maximum Annual Benefit (INR) | Key Eligibility Aspects |
|---|---|---|---|
| SC/ST | Merit Scholarship to College/Professional Institutions, Post Matric Scholarship. | Up to 10,000 (Delhi State Schemes) | Valid caste certificate, academic performance, income criteria for some schemes. |
| OBC | Merit Scholarship to College/Professional Institutions, Post Matric Scholarship for OBC Students. | Up to 10,000 (Delhi State Schemes) | Valid OBC certificate, income criteria, academic performance. |
| Minorities | Merit Scholarship to College/Professional Institutions (Minorities specific). | Up to 10,000 (Delhi State Schemes) | Valid minority certificate, academic performance. |
| Economically Weaker Sections (EWS) | NIT Delhi Internal Assistance, various state schemes based on income. | Varies by scheme and need. | Income certificate, academic standing. |
| General (Merit-based) | NIT Delhi Internal Assistance, certain private scholarships. | Varies by scheme and merit. | |
| Persons with Disabilities (PwD) | Central Sector Scheme of Scholarship for Top Class Education for PwD students. | Varies (Tuition fees, maintenance allowance). | Disability certificate, admission to approved institution. |

How much scholarship can a student get at NIT Delhi?
Students at NIT Delhi can receive scholarships ranging from Rs. 5,000 to Rs. 10,000 annually through various state and central government schemes. Internal institute aid also provides financial support based on merit and need.
Which government bodies offer scholarships to NIT Delhi students?
The Ministry of Social Justice and Empowerment, Government of India, and the Government of NCT of Delhi are key authorities. NIT Delhi's Scholarship Cell also coordinates various financial assistance programs.
What are the key eligibility criteria for scholarships at NIT Delhi?
Primary criteria include caste (SC/ST/OBC/Minority), Delhi domicile for state schemes, Aadhaar, previous year's mark sheet, and income proof for economically weaker sections.
When is the application window for Delhi government scholarships for 2025-26?
For the 2025-26 academic year, applications via e-District Delhi Portal are invited from October 31, 2025, with a deadline of March 31, 2026. Specific schemes like Pre & Post Matric SC/OBC have different windows.
Are there merit-based scholarships available for all students at NIT Delhi?
Yes, NIT Delhi provides internal financial assistance to meritorious students. While many government schemes are category-specific, the institute also supports students based on academic performance and other criteria.
